AI Tools for Enhanced Language Translation
Let’s take a look at some powerful AI-driven tools that are actively breaking down language barriers:
- DeepL: This translation tool is highly regarded for its accuracy and ability to grasp nuances and context, resulting in translations that sound natural and fluent. It supports a wide range of languages and offers a user-friendly interface.
- Google Translate: A mainstay in the world of machine translation, Google Translate offers support for over 100 languages. It continues to improve, and now provides real-time translation capabilities, document translation, and even website translation.
- Grammarly: While primarily known for its grammar and spell-checking prowess, Grammarly also offers helpful translation features, aiding non-native speakers in understanding English text and suggesting better ways to convey their message.
- Reverso: This comprehensive platform combines translation with additional language learning resources like conjugation tools, contextual examples, and flashcards, making it an excellent choice for those actively working on their language skills.

Challenges and Considerations
As with any emerging technology, AI-powered multilingual interfaces come with their own set of challenges and considerations. It’s important to acknowledge these to ensure the responsible and effective implementation of this technology.
- Capturing Nuances and Complexities: While AI language models have grown incredibly sophisticated, capturing every linguistic subtlety remains a challenge. Idioms, slang, and cultural references might not always translate seamlessly, highlighting the ongoing need for refinement in these systems.
- Data Bias and Accuracy: The performance of AI models depends significantly on the data they’re trained on. If the training data is biased or contains inaccuracies, these can creep into the translations, leading to misunderstandings. It’s important for developers to address data bias and prioritize quality control.
- Accessibility and Inclusivity: The benefits of AI for language translation should extend to everyone, not just the tech-savvy. Designing user-friendly interfaces and addressing the potential impact on those with limited digital literacy is crucial for a truly inclusive approach.
